Question:
.A fiberglass composite is composed of a matrix of vinyl ester and reinforcing fibres of Eglass. The volume fraction of E-glass is 40%. The remainder is vinyl ester. The density of the silicone epoxy is 1.04 g/cm3 , and its modulus of elasticity is 4.60 GPa. The density of E-glass is 2.60 g/cm3 , and its modulus of elasticity is 76.0 GPa. A section of composite 2.00 cm x 25.00 cm x 200.00 cm is fabricated with the E-glass fibres running longitudinal along the 200-cm direction. Assume there are no voids in the composite. Determine the a. mass of silicone epoxy in the section, b. mass of E-glass fibres in the section, and c. the density of the composite d. the modulus of elasticity in the longitudinal direction of the glass fibres e. modulus of elasticity in the perpendicular direction to the glass fibres. f. if E-glass fibres are replaced with carbon fibres having density of 1.75 g/3 and modulus of 332 GPa, what would be effect on weight to modulus ratio in comparison to composite containing E-glass fibres in same volume fraction?
